Установка Freeswitch в данной статье производится на Centos 6 ветки точно так же ставится на RHEL, OracleLinux/
Подготовим систему
обновим
yum update
Отключим selinux
vi /etc/sysconfig/selinux
SELINUX=disabled
погасим фаервол
chkconfig iptables stop
перезагрузимся
reboot
Устанавливаем необходимые компоненты
yum install git gcc-c++ autoconf automake libtool wget python make expat-devel ncurses-devel zlib zlib-devel e2fsprogs-devel libjpeg-devel unixODBC-devel openssl-devel sqlite-devel libcurl-devel pcre-devel speex-devel gnutls-devel libogg-devel libvorbis-devel curl-devel gdbm gdbm-devel libedit-devel ldns dns-devel libldns-dev
Непосредственно установка из исходников
cd /usr/src
git clone -b v1.4 https://freeswitch.org/stash/scm/fs/freeswitch.git
git clone -b v1.6 https://freeswitch.org/stash/scm/fs/freeswitch.git
cd /usr/src/freeswitch
./bootstrap.sh –j